EDIT: Anybody tested HDMI out?
I did...

apparently there are several thread on XDA about this...

anyway to quote what I posted here -> http://xdaforums.com/showpost.php?p=15836523&postcount=12

Its working pretty good on my VZW 3G Xoom (over wifi... as I don't have 3G service activted on my Xoom)

And as an added bonus... HDMI out to my TV continues playing the movie!! (i.e. started playing a movie on the XOOM, then connected microHDMI cable to the TV, and the movie is playing on both the Xoom screen and TV Screen). It looks better on the Xoom screen, as with other attempts at video out across microHDMI to the TV, video is a little jerky and too warm.
